Technical Considerations and Fabric Challenges

However, we must be realistic about the challenges. Just because a graphic looks good on a screen doesn't mean it stitches out perfectly on every surface. If you are planning to adapt Bulldog Tumbler Sublimation 20 Oz Skinny for embroidery, you need to be mindful of fabric texture. On a fuzzy fleece or a loose-knit sweater, fine details in the bulldog's facial features might get swallowed up. In these cases, simplifying the stitch density and opting for broader fill areas is crucial.

Another critical factor is the hoop size. While the design is wide, ensure your machine can accommodate the height if you plan to scale it down for smaller items like baby embroidery projects or caps. Speaking of caps, curved surfaces are tricky. A design this wide might require splitting or significant push-pull compensation adjustments to prevent distortion on a structured baseball cap. Always test on scrap fabric first. There is nothing worse than ruining a client's garment because you didn't account for the stretch of a jersey knit or the pile of a towel.

Color contrast is also paramount. The original graphic likely relies on specific color interactions to define the bulldog's shape. When converting to thread, you must verify that your chosen thread colors provide enough contrast against the garment color. A dark bulldog on a navy blue sweatshirt will vanish. You may need to introduce an underlay or a backing patch to ensure the design pops. Additionally, check the small details. Tiny lettering or intricate whisker details often need to be removed or thickened when moving from a 300 DPI print file to a stitch file to prevent breakage after washing.
